The first step is to recognize that lights can
accomplish much more than just beautifying
your property. They can provide safety, security,
functionality, and benefit the environment.

Improve Security
Provide sufficient illumination in critical areas
throughout your property to deter, detect, and
identify intruders,
Ensure Safety
Prevent trips and falls by illurninating paths,
pool areas, steps, docks, and other places with
‘obstacles or changes in elevation.
Create a Masterpiece
Lighting can reveal beauty already present and
create new beauty through the interplay
between light and shadow. Selectively
lluminate objects you love and cast shadows to
make surfaces more interesting.

Spotlights are used for emphasis, caling attention to specific architectural or landscape
features. Spotlights use a narrow beam, drawing focus to one object at a time. The
Intention of lighting your home is not to flood it with light, making it look overt, You
should use spotlights selectively to apply creetive, visual accents to your home.

Dowinlighting is a landscape lighting technique used to simulate moonlighting. This is accomplished through installing
downlight fixtures in trees or high trellises or other structures,

Flood lights are used to illuminate walls, signs, tree canopies, and similar applications requiring wide spread lighting. They
‘can be used for wall washing and grazing techniques as well as provide safety and security for yards and other large,
outdoor areas,

WELL LIGHTING DESIGN TIPS
Use well lights for below-ground applications,
1. Lawns
Use well lights when fixture location must be in your lawn, Since
these fixtures are level with the ground’s surface, they willbe safe
from lawn mowers and other darnaging lawn equipment.
2. Decks, Docks, Patios, and Pathways
Well lights are great for these applications because again, they are
level witn the grounds surface. Ths allows them to integrate
with ‘hard’ surfaces, Our high-quality products will stan up to foot
and vehicle traffic in these areas as well
3. Columns
Well lights are great for lighting colurnns because their light source
's low to the ground, This means that you ray light columns or
other features from the ground up with no dark spots at the base of
the feature

Low voltage landscape lighting transformers are designed for easy installation, consistent performance, and enduring
longevity. They work forall types of low voltage outdoor lighting
AMP® Slim Line and Clamp-Connect Series
These transformers are specifically designed for LED systems and feature the exceptional clamp-type terminal blocks for
‘ast and secure connections. These transformers are limited to 12V and 15V taps since LED systems accommodate a
wide range of acceptable vohage.
AMP® Multi-Tap Series Transformers
These transformers feature 12V, 13V, 14V, and 1SV voltage taps,
AMP® PRO Series
These transformers feature voltage taps from 12V through 22V,
AMP® Dual Circuit Transformer
This transformer has two timer and photocell slots to run two independently controlled landscape lighting systems from
fone unit, Ideal for homes and properties that have rutiple lighting zones or security lighting,
